Nov. 27th, 2009 01:44 pmSo, there's this Canadian comedy show called This Hour Has 22 Minutes. And usually, I don't find it all that hilarious.
But! One of the actors, Mary Walsh, has a running gag where she plays a character called Marg Delahunty, an opinionated Newfoundland reporter, and last week Marg Delahunty went to a Sarah Palin book signing at a Borders store, and asked Ms. Palin if she had any words of advice for Canadian conservatives who were trying to get rid of socialized medicine.*
THIS IS WHAT HAPPENED:
(If you can't see the embed, the clip is here on YouTube.)
* There are (practically) no Canadians who want to get rid of socialized medicine (link to a Raw Story piece about polling on this issue.) Walsh was being hilarious.
